Let $\left({p_{n - 1}, p_n, p_{n + 1} }\right)$ be a triplet of consecutive prime numbers.

$p_n$ is a balanced prime if and only if:

$p_n = \dfrac {p_{n - 1} + p_{n + 1} } 2$
